An "over the counter" medication, also known as "OTC", is a medication that can be purchased at a supermarket or pharmacy without a prescription. Examples are common pain relievers, cough and cold medicine or allergy medications. Remember to only take medications as directed, and that exceeding the recommended dosage could be harmful or fatal. With any new symptoms or condition, you should consult your health care professional for advice prior to beginning any treatment on your own.
